How much do First-Line Supervisors of Police and Detectives make?
Your level of experience is a key factor in determining your earning potential. Here's what you can expect at different career stages:
0-2 years
Hourly Rate
$39.65/hr
Range: $37.77 - $41.54
Annual Rate
$82,480
Range: $78,552 - $86,408
3-5 years
Hourly Rate
$46.65/hr
Range: $44.43 - $48.87
Annual Rate
$97,035
Range: $92,414 - $101,656
6+ years
Hourly Rate
$53.65/hr
Range: $51.09 - $56.20
Annual Rate
$111,590
Range: $106,276 - $116,904
